Step-by-step explanation:
First, we must arrange this equation into slope-intercept form, or y=mx+b form.
Equation: y-8=2x
Add 8 to both sides: y=2x+8
Now that the equation is in slope-intercept form, it is easy to find the y-intercept, as it is just the b-value.
In this case, the b-value is 8, so the y-intercept is (0,8).

To calculate the length of the diagonal, use the Pythagorean theorem:
c^2 = a^2 + b^2, where c is the diagonal.
c^2 = 65^2 + 34^2
c^2 = 4225 + 1156
c^2 = 5381
c ~ 73.36
To the nearest tenth of a meter, the diagonal has a length of 73.4 m
